Harish-Chandra Theorem for Two-parameter Quantum Groups

arXiv:2402.12793 · doi:10.1515/forum-2024-0089

Abstract

This paper is devoted to investigating the centre of two-parameter quantum groups via establishing the Harish-Chandra homomorphism. Based on the Rosso form and the representation theory of weight modules, we prove that when rank is even, the Harish-Chandra homomorphism is an isomorphism, and in particular, the centre of the quantum group of the weight lattice type is a polynomial algebra , where canonical central elements are turned out to be uniformly expressed. For rank to be odd, we figure out a new invertible extra central generator , which doesn't survive in , then the centre of contains , where , except for .
